﻿<?xml version="1.0" encoding="utf-8"?><Type Name="ValidationType" FullName="System.Xml.ValidationType"><TypeSignature Maintainer="auto" Language="C#" Value="public enum ValidationType" /><TypeSignature Language="ILAsm" Value=".class public auto ansi sealed ValidationType extends System.Enum" /><AssemblyInfo><AssemblyName>System.Xml</AssemblyName><AssemblyPublicKey>[00 00 00 00 00 00 00 00 04 00 00 00 00 00 00 00]</AssemblyPublicKey><AssemblyVersion>1.0.5000.0</AssemblyVersion><AssemblyVersion>2.0.0.0</AssemblyVersion><AssemblyVersion>4.0.0.0</AssemblyVersion></AssemblyInfo><ThreadSafetyStatement>To be added</ThreadSafetyStatement><Base><BaseTypeName>System.Enum</BaseTypeName></Base><Docs><remarks><attribution license="cc4" from="Microsoft" modified="false" /><para>The <see cref="T:System.Xml.XmlReader" /> class can enforce validation using a schema or document type definition (DTD). The <see cref="T:System.Xml.ValidationType" /> enumeration specifies the type of validation the created <see cref="T:System.Xml.XmlReader" /> instance should perform. The <see cref="T:System.Xml.XmlReader" /> instance can be either a validating <see cref="T:System.Xml.XmlReader" /> object created by the <see cref="Overload:System.Xml.XmlReader.Create" /> method, or an <see cref="T:System.Xml.XmlValidatingReader" /> object.</para><para>The validation model has three characteristics, strict, informative, and status. Strict, does not allow the mixing of validation types, informative provides a warning if the schema or document type definition (DTD) cannot be found, and status provides warnings if validation cannot be performed for elements and attributes from schemas.</para></remarks><summary><attribution license="cc4" from="Microsoft" modified="false" /><para>Specifies the type of validation to perform.</para></summary></Docs><Members><Member MemberName="Auto"><MemberSignature Language="C#" Value="Auto" /><MemberSignature Language="ILAsm" Value=".field public static literal valuetype System.Xml.ValidationType Auto = int32(1)" /><MemberType>Field</MemberType><AssemblyInfo><AssemblyVersion>1.0.5000.0</AssemblyVersion><AssemblyVersion>2.0.0.0</AssemblyVersion><AssemblyVersion>4.0.0.0</AssemblyVersion></AssemblyInfo><Attributes><Attribute><AttributeName>System.Obsolete</AttributeName></Attribute></Attributes><ReturnValue><ReturnType>System.Xml.ValidationType</ReturnType></ReturnValue><Parameters /><Docs><remarks><attribution license="cc4" from="Microsoft" modified="false" /><block subset="none" type="note"><para> This field is obsolete in the Microsoft .NET Framework version 2.0 and is applicable only to the <see cref="T:System.Xml.XmlValidatingReader" /> class.</para></block></remarks><summary><attribution license="cc4" from="Microsoft" modified="false" /><para>Validates if DTD or schema information is found.</para></summary></Docs></Member><Member MemberName="DTD"><MemberSignature Language="C#" Value="DTD" /><MemberSignature Language="ILAsm" Value=".field public static literal valuetype System.Xml.ValidationType DTD = int32(2)" /><MemberType>Field</MemberType><AssemblyInfo><AssemblyVersion>1.0.5000.0</AssemblyVersion><AssemblyVersion>2.0.0.0</AssemblyVersion><AssemblyVersion>4.0.0.0</AssemblyVersion></AssemblyInfo><ReturnValue><ReturnType>System.Xml.ValidationType</ReturnType></ReturnValue><Parameters /><Docs><remarks>To be added</remarks><summary><attribution license="cc4" from="Microsoft" modified="false" /><para>Validates according to the DTD.</para></summary></Docs></Member><Member MemberName="None"><MemberSignature Language="C#" Value="None" /><MemberSignature Language="ILAsm" Value=".field public static literal valuetype System.Xml.ValidationType None = int32(0)" /><MemberType>Field</MemberType><AssemblyInfo><AssemblyVersion>1.0.5000.0</AssemblyVersion><AssemblyVersion>2.0.0.0</AssemblyVersion><AssemblyVersion>4.0.0.0</AssemblyVersion></AssemblyInfo><ReturnValue><ReturnType>System.Xml.ValidationType</ReturnType></ReturnValue><Parameters /><Docs><remarks><attribution license="cc4" from="Microsoft" modified="false" /><para>Default attributes are reported and general entities can be resolved by calling <see cref="M:System.Xml.XmlReader.ResolveEntity" />. The DOCTYPE is not used for validation purposes.</para><para>No validation errors are thrown.</para></remarks><summary><attribution license="cc4" from="Microsoft" modified="false" /><para>No validation is performed. This setting creates an XML 1.0 compliant non-validating parser.</para></summary></Docs></Member><Member MemberName="Schema"><MemberSignature Language="C#" Value="Schema" /><MemberSignature Language="ILAsm" Value=".field public static literal valuetype System.Xml.ValidationType Schema = int32(4)" /><MemberType>Field</MemberType><AssemblyInfo><AssemblyVersion>1.0.5000.0</AssemblyVersion><AssemblyVersion>2.0.0.0</AssemblyVersion><AssemblyVersion>4.0.0.0</AssemblyVersion></AssemblyInfo><ReturnValue><ReturnType>System.Xml.ValidationType</ReturnType></ReturnValue><Parameters /><Docs><remarks>To be added</remarks><summary><attribution license="cc4" from="Microsoft" modified="false" /><para>Validate according to XML Schema definition language (XSD) schemas, including inline XML Schemas. XML Schemas are associated with namespace URIs either by using the schemaLocation attribute or the provided Schemas property.</para></summary></Docs></Member><Member MemberName="XDR"><MemberSignature Language="C#" Value="XDR" /><MemberSignature Language="ILAsm" Value=".field public static literal valuetype System.Xml.ValidationType XDR = int32(3)" /><MemberType>Field</MemberType><AssemblyInfo><AssemblyVersion>1.0.5000.0</AssemblyVersion><AssemblyVersion>2.0.0.0</AssemblyVersion><AssemblyVersion>4.0.0.0</AssemblyVersion></AssemblyInfo><Attributes><Attribute><AttributeName>System.Obsolete</AttributeName></Attribute></Attributes><ReturnValue><ReturnType>System.Xml.ValidationType</ReturnType></ReturnValue><Parameters /><Docs><remarks><attribution license="cc4" from="Microsoft" modified="false" /><block subset="none" type="note"><para> This field is obsolete in the Microsoft .NET Framework version 2.0 and is applicable only to the <see cref="T:System.Xml.XmlValidatingReader" /> class.</para></block></remarks><summary><attribution license="cc4" from="Microsoft" modified="false" /><para>Validate according to XML-Data Reduced (XDR) schemas, including inline XDR schemas. XDR schemas are recognized using the x-schema namespace prefix or the <see cref="P:System.Xml.XmlValidatingReader.Schemas" /> property.</para></summary></Docs></Member></Members></Type>